Object Avoidance

Object avoidance functions allow your robot to avoid crashing into things like toys, power cords and clothes that can get caught up in the automatic vacuum cleaner. These features are especially important if your family has pets or children that could leave objects on the floor for your robot to discover.

Based on the model you choose You may have an array of different sensors that can help your robot navigate around obstacles. Some of the most sought-after include crossed IR sensor beams, which are a focused infrared light which scan the room looking for things like furniture legs or door frames. Many robots have adopted this technology, and you'll find it in the flagship models that cost more.

Other object avoidance technologies that are typically found in more expensive robots include 3D Structured Light, which utilizes cameras and crossed IR sensors to map the environment and detect obstacles. Also, Time of Flight (ToF) sensors which emit and measure the time it takes for light to reflect off of objects to determine the distance between them. While these are less common, they can be beneficial to your robot if you need extra peace of mind that it won't get caught up in cables or socks while cleaning.

Mapping

Robot vacuums must be able to map. This lets them navigate your home and avoid bumping against things like walls. Without mapping, Best Rated Robot Vacuum they could be tripped over by furniture, cords or pet toys, and end up removing less of your space. By using sensors, many robots map out your space to track any obstacles and assist them to navigate around them. They can clean your floors in fewer passes and make it easier for you to save time. Many of the best robot vacuums also have this feature, which allows you to create no-go areas.

Robots equipped with LIDAR use this technology to map your home efficiently and quickly. In our tests with the Eufy Clean robot made use of this feature to separate my room into various areas and clean each one independently, which was a huge improvement over the lesser models we tested that utilized a front bump sensor. This was a much more precise method of navigating my home and was also easy to control via the app on the device.

While no robot vacuum is able to climb stairs yet, the majority of the best rated models come with obstacle avoidance and mapping features. These tools let them collect dirt from low-pile or hard floors, and prevent falling down the stairs. Some have cliff sensors that stop them from crossing over the edge of the stairs and some also have boundary strips that can keep them away from certain areas.

Some robots have a large base tower that collects dirt. This helps reduce the amount of dust or allergens that are released in your home. The bases can be kept for weeks or months without having to be cleaned which is particularly beneficial for those who suffer from allergies. Some models come with self-emptying dust bins that can empty without opening and closing them manually.

Maintenance

Having a robot vacuum is a great aid in keeping up with your home. The best models can pick up more dirt pet hair, and lint than a broom on low-pile or hard floors. They come with navigational features that keep them from getting stuck on power cords, rug fringe or furniture.

Based on the model, a highly rated robot cleaner with mop vacuum is also able to run several times per day or allow you to watch it at work via an app. However, these useful machines are also susceptible to clogging and require regular maintenance such as emptying the bin onboard (or the base's larger dust bin in some cases) as well as checking the brushes for hair that is tangled, and regularly rinsing and letting the filters dry according to the manufacturer.

Vacuum expert Emily Rairdin, a store owner apprentice at University Vacuum + Sewing, says a good robot vacuum will last for three to five years or more with regular care and attention. She recommends regularly emptying the brush roll and bin and cutting out hair that's tangled in the brushes, and regularly washing and drying the filter, when your robot is also used as a mop. It's also a good idea to clean the charging contacts and sensors on the robot or dock every now and then with a soft cloth.
